What Your Retail Packaging Solutions Need to Achieve

Retail packaging is not the same as shipping packaging, and that distinction really matters once you start thinking about your product on the shelf.

A postal mailer just needs to make it from A to B without taking damage along the way. Retail packaging has to do all of that too, and then sell your product once it arrives on the shop shelf in front of real buyers.

Once it’s on a shop shelf, your box is up against every other product in the category for the shopper’s attention. You’ve got about seven seconds before a customer decides whether to pick it up or move on, and that’s not a lot of time at all.

So your retail packaging has got to shield the product through transport and handling, express your brand loud and clear at point of sale, and still meet the practical requirements of whichever retailer is actually stocking it on the shelf.

Miss the mark on any one of those, and it does not really matter how good the product inside is. If shoppers aren’t picking it up to try it out, they’ll never know how good it actually is, and you’ve lost the sale before it even started.

Folding Cartons and Product Boxes

These are the standard retail boxes you see in health shops, department stores, and specialist retailers. Reverse tuck-end boxes. Crash-lock bottom boxes. Auto-lock cartons. All of them fall squarely into this category of folding carton.

They arrive flat, assemble quickly, and give you full control over the print and finish on every panel of the box. The board is strong and protective, keeping your product safe through the supply chain while still looking sharp at point of sale.

Custom Sleeves and Bands

A printed sleeve wraps around your product or its primary container, adding branding to the package while leaving the existing packaging exactly where it is. This works really well for multi-packs, gift sets, and products where you want to add a seasonal or promotional message without redesigning the entire box every time.

Sleeves are quick to produce and easy to swap out as soon as your promotion changes, which means you can keep pace with every new season.

Layout and the Information Hierarchy

Front panel, back panel, side panels, each one has a role. The front panel sells, the back panel informs, and the side panels carry the regulatory detail the law demands you include.

Cramming everything onto one face is a common mistake. Especially for brands with a lot of compliance information to include somewhere on the box.

How the Box Feels in Your Hands

What a box feels like matters far more than most brands realise, and it only really clicks once you start paying proper attention.

Run your finger over a matte lamination and then over a gloss one, and you can feel the difference straight away. Soft-touch coating makes people hold the box longer, and embossed lettering invites the fingers to keep touching it.

These details may seem small when taken one at a time, but in a retail environment where customers are comparing products sitting literally side by side, they add up fast and influence the choice.

Retail Protective Packaging Options

Retail packaging does not just need to look good on the shelf to earn its place. It needs to keep your product safe from the packing line to the shop shelf. That means thinking about how the box handles stacking, how it behaves in transit, and whether it protects against moisture, dust, or impact.

Got fragile items? We build internal fitments, inserts, and dividers into the box design itself, so your product stays secure without needing bubble wrap or loose fill. The knock-on effect: packing efficiency improves for your team, and the customer has less packaging to throw away.

If your product ships direct to consumer as well as going to retail, our protective packaging specialists can design packaging that works well across both sales channels without any compromise.

One box that performs on a shop shelf and also survives a courier trip means less complexity in your operation and fewer SKUs for your team to manage day to day.
